Method
Salad greens & vegetables
- 1
Rinse the mixed greens thoroughly under cold running water, then spin in a salad spinner or pat dry with clean kitchen towels until mostly dry.
- 2
Place the dried greens in a large mixing bowl.
- 3
Add the halved cherry tomatoes, sliced cucumber, thinly sliced red onion, and shredded carrot to the bowl and gently toss to combine.
Toppings (optional)
- 4
- 5
If using avocado, slice just before serving to prevent browning and set aside.
- 6
Sprinkle the crumbled cheese and toasted nuts/seeds over the tossed salad when ready to dress.
Simple vinaigrette
- 7
Whisked vinaigrette
In a small bowl or jar, combine the red wine vinegar (or lemon juice), Dijon mustard, honey, and minced garlic. Add the salt and pepper, then slowly whisk in the olive oil until the dressing emulsifies and thickens slightly. Taste and adjust seasoning.
- 8
If using a jar, secure the lid and shake vigorously for 20–30 seconds until well combined.
- 9
Just before serving, drizzle approximately 2–3 tablespoons of vinaigrette over the salad and gently toss to coat. Add additional dressing to taste.
- 10
Plate the salad in four side-salad portions (about 1 cup each). Garnish with avocado slices, extra cheese, or a final grind of black pepper as desired.
